Moss Point to Commemorate Its Freedom Summer History
Moss Point, Mississippi, is set to honor its significant role in the Civil Rights Movement with a new memorial project spearheaded by the Mississippi Humanities Council. This initiative aims to highlight the town's involvement during the pivotal Freedom Summer of 1964, a time when activists courageously fought for racial equality.
